Transaction 8a2546d33fe4e13a84d1c8bc8024c56dae6c42286f2ac355d23ed71b1c752909

block
a6c073cb1c324ae8e8097448ece0aa36be0c2032d3f713741186f356540cae07

146 Inputs

2001 Outputs